Yes it is possible to find a good company or guide once you have landed in Kathmandu but it will take a few good days work if you don%26#39;t already know which company to contact.





I presume you are going to do a ';lodge'; trekking. Accommodation in Everest area is not expensive if you are going to eat in the same lodge. I would say 600 - 700 Rs a day should be enough for food and accommodation. Any other expenditure is not included of course such as beer, coke, fags etc.





Hiring a guide in Kathmandu can be expensive for this trip as then you have to pay for his/her flight as well. You can find a guide in Lukla and I would say it might cost around 300 - 500 Rs per day (by the way even if the cost of hiring a guide may seem little more expensive, I think they worth the cost as these people really work hard and deserve every single Rs).





Other cost include: flight in and out of Lukla from Kathmandu (2500 to 3500 Rs single journey) airport departure tax (500-600 Rs), National park entrance fee (1000 Rs) and some tipping at the end of the trip and may be some cash for a ';last day of the trip Party!





The above amount might differ a bit as they are based on my last trip however they should not be that different.
